CIN Offense vs DEN Defense
Cincy can do two things very well. First, they run a zone-block run scheme (with and without one-cut running) between the tackles. Second, they have three capable receivers and they like to threaten the deep pass. Carson Palmer is one of the better QBs in the NFL, and he has three terrific targets in Chad Ochocinco, Laveranues Coles and Chris Henry. Cedric ...

... What happened to Chad Ochocinco? At one point, Chad Ochocinco was on pace for 220 yards receiving on 12 receptions. In the first quarter, Chad caught three passes for 55 yards receiving. Then he disappeared for two quarters. In fact, you have to go all the way until there's seven minutes left in the game the next time Chad was targeted as a receiver in an attempted pass. Roughly 42 minutes and 27 seconds had passed between receptions for Chad. ...
